Doppler Radar
Doppler radar is essentially the most broadly used radar system within the NWS community. It makes use of the Doppler impact to measure the frequency shift attributable to transferring objects, equivalent to raindrops or tornadoes. The system is able to detecting wind velocities and particles signatures, permitting meteorologists to trace extreme climate techniques intimately. Doppler radar can also be efficient in detecting tornadoes, with its sensitivity to rotating columns of air.
Phased Array Radar
Phased array radar is a more recent know-how that provides improved decision and sooner processing speeds in comparison with conventional Doppler radar. This technique makes use of a big array of antenna components that may be steered electronically to trace a number of storms concurrently. Phased array radar supplies extra detailed data on storm depth and motion, enabling meteorologists to situation extra correct forecasts and warnings.
